Saga Falabella S.A. said its third-quarter normalized net income was 13 Peruvian céntimos per share, an increase of 8.2% from 12 céntimos per share in the prior-year period.
Normalized net income, which excludes unusual gains or losses on a pre- and after-tax basis, was 31.8 million soles, an increase of 8.2% from 29.4 million soles in the prior-year period.
The normalized profit margin increased to 4.4% from 4.2% in the year-earlier period.
Total revenue increased year over year to 732.2 million soles from 703.2 million soles, and total operating expenses grew year over year to 694.9 million soles from 669.5 million soles.
Reported net income increased 5.1% on an annual basis to 35.0 million soles, or 14 céntimos per share, from 33.3 million soles, or 13 céntimos per share.
As of Oct. 28, US$1 was equivalent to 3.37 soles.
